Tapiola in world map

Tapiola in world map. The following map shows the location of Tapiola in the world. Latitude and longitude of Tapiola: 60°29'08.8"N, 22°52'53.8"E

Please select map: Tapiola in world mapMap of Tapiola
Tapiola in world map
Tapiola, Finland in world map